It started from the day when we’re still strangers
We were hesitant of initiating a talk with the others
Picturesque smiles were kept hidden
Perhaps because we were fearful of being joked on.

Days have passed since the first day we met
Little by little, to friendship this conversation has led
We started considering others as our companion
They are those who share the same interest and passion.

‘Twas astonishing that years have already passed
We made friendship that we never knew would last
Those pitfalls that we faced as partners
Pushed us to become closer and stronger.

Hoping that you’ll never erase me from your memory
Even though you are not here with me
You’re still the one, cannot be replaced
Till the end of time, you will always be my friend.
